Making WordPress.org


Ignore:
Timestamp:
01/12/2022 07:19:37 AM (4 years ago)
Author:
dd32
Message:

Themes: Convert WordPress.org themes to use add_theme_supprt( 'title-tag' ); rather than a private global.

See https://github.com/WordPress/wporg-mu-plugins/issues/44

File:
1 edited

Legend:

Unmodified
Added
Removed
  • sites/trunk/wordpress.org/public_html/wp-content/themes/pub/wporg-makehome/functions.php

    r10966 r11431  
    1111    register_nav_menu( 'primary', __( 'Navigation Menu', 'make-wporg' ) );
    1212    add_theme_support( 'post-thumbnails' );
     13    add_theme_support( 'title-tag' );
    1314}
    1415
     
    4647
    4748/**
    48  * Omit page name from front page title.
     49 * Set page name for front page title.
    4950 *
    5051 * @param array $parts The document title parts.
    5152 * @return array The document title parts.
    5253 */
    53 function make_remove_frontpage_name_from_title( $parts ) {
     54function make_add_frontpage_name_to_title( $parts ) {
    5455    if ( is_front_page() ) {
    55         $parts['title'] = '';
     56        $parts['title'] = 'Get Involved';
     57        $parts['site']  = 'WordPress.org';
    5658    }
    5759
    5860    return $parts; 
    5961}
    60 add_filter( 'document_title_parts', 'make_remove_frontpage_name_from_title' );
     62add_filter( 'document_title_parts', 'make_add_frontpage_name_to_title' );
    6163
Note: See TracChangeset for help on using the changeset viewer.